首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

读取requirements.txt文件时可能出现的pip模块问题

是指在使用pip工具安装Python包时,由于requirements.txt文件中指定的包版本或依赖关系与当前环境不兼容,导致安装失败或出现其他错误的情况。

解决这类问题的方法包括:

  1. 确保pip版本较新:使用pip install --upgrade pip命令升级pip工具到最新版本,以确保具备最新的功能和修复的bug。
  2. 检查requirements.txt文件:检查requirements.txt文件中指定的包名称和版本是否正确,确保没有拼写错误或者版本号不符合要求的情况。
  3. 清空缓存并重新安装:使用pip cache purge命令清空pip缓存,然后使用pip install -r requirements.txt命令重新安装依赖包。
  4. 升级或降级包版本:根据错误提示信息,尝试升级或降级requirements.txt文件中指定的包版本,以解决与当前环境不兼容的问题。
  5. 使用虚拟环境:使用虚拟环境(如venv或conda)来隔离不同项目的依赖关系,避免不同项目之间的包冲突。
  6. 手动安装依赖包:如果pip安装失败,可以尝试手动下载依赖包的源码,然后使用pip install <package_name>命令进行本地安装。
  7. 查找替代包:如果某个包无法安装或不再维护,可以查找并尝试使用替代的包来满足需求。

需要注意的是,以上方法仅为常见解决方案,具体解决方法可能因具体情况而异。在解决pip模块问题时,可以参考腾讯云提供的云服务器(CVM)产品,该产品提供了灵活可扩展的计算能力,适用于各种应用场景。详情请参考腾讯云云服务器产品介绍:https://cloud.tencent.com/product/cvm

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券